Compact E-Ink HAT for Raspberry Pi and Jetson Nano

This 2.13inch development board adds a black-and-white e-paper screen to Raspberry Pi 5, 4B, 3B+, 3B, 2B, A+, Zero variants and Jetson Nano through the 40PIN GPIO header. Makers building low-power IoT nodes or dashboard prototypes can attach it directly without extra wiring. The module suits projects that need persistent text or graphics while the host is asleep.

250x122 pixel resolution

The display shows 250 by 122 pixels in two colours and communicates through a standard SPI interface. An embedded controller handles the driving waveforms, so the host only sends image data. Partial refresh lets you update small areas quickly, which is useful for counters, sensors or status icons that change often.

Plugs straight onto the 40PIN header

Onboard voltage translation makes the HAT compatible with both 3.3V and 5V microcontrollers, including Arduino and STM32 boards. No soldering is required; the board seats on the GPIO pins and draws power only during refresh cycles. Online resources provide driver schematics and example code for Raspberry Pi, Jetson Nano, Arduino and STM32 platforms.

Vragen over dit artikel

How does the 250x122 resolution look on the 2.13 inch screen?

The 250 by 122 pixel grid gives crisp black and white text and simple graphics on the 2.13 inch diagonal, suitable for status readouts or basic icons.

What does the SPI interface limit in practice?

SPI keeps wiring to a few pins and works with 3.3V or 5V logic, but refresh speed is capped by the serial clock so full screen updates take a noticeable moment.

Will the 40 pin header fit my Raspberry Pi Zero 2 W?

Yes, the 40 pin GPIO extension header aligns with every Raspberry Pi model listed including the Zero 2 W, and the onboard voltage translator handles both 3.3V and 5V logic levels.
